Key Benchmarking Tools for Sony Xperia

Benchmarking tools provide a quantitative analysis of the performance capabilities of Sony Xperia smartphones. These tools serve to measure various aspects of device performance, including CPU and GPU efficiency, ensuring that users can make informed decisions based on empirical data.

Geekbench is one of the most widely recognized benchmarking tools, primarily focusing on CPU performance. It provides separate scores for both single-core and multi-core processing capabilities, allowing users to gauge the raw processing power of different Sony Xperia models.

AnTuTu is another significant tool that offers a comprehensive assessment of overall device performance. It evaluates multiple components, including graphics, memory, and UX performance, giving an extensive overview of how a Sony Xperia phone will perform in everyday tasks.

3DMark specializes in assessing graphical performance, particularly in gaming scenarios. By analyzing how well a device can handle graphics-intensive applications, 3DMark provides insights specifically relevant to gamers and those interested in mobile graphics performance.

3DMark

3DMark is a widely recognized benchmarking tool specifically designed to evaluate the graphics performance of mobile devices, including Sony Xperia smartphones. This application focuses on assessing the GPU capabilities by simulating demanding gaming environments. It provides scores that reflect how well a device handles graphics-intensive tasks.

The benchmarks in 3DMark include various tests, such as the 3DMark Wildlife test, which is optimized for mobile devices. This test measures the graphical prowess under real-world gaming scenarios. For example, a high score in this benchmark indicates that the Sony Xperia device can render complex graphics smoothly, essential for immersive gaming experiences.

In addition to graphics performance, 3DMark also evaluates the thermal management and stability of the device during stress tests. Sony Xperia phones typically perform well in these benchmarks due to their advanced cooling systems, which help to maintain optimal performance over extended periods of use.

By analyzing the 3DMark scores, users can gain valuable insights into the gaming capabilities and overall performance of Sony Xperia smartphones. This information is particularly useful for users who prioritize mobile gaming or utilize graphic-intensive applications on their devices.

Sony Xperia Performance Benchmarks: GPU Performance

In assessing Sony Xperia performance benchmarks, GPU performance serves as a critical factor in determining how well these devices handle graphical tasks. Graphic Processing Units (GPUs) are responsible for rendering images, animations, and videos, significantly impacting gaming and multimedia experiences.

Several key benchmarks illustrate the GPU capabilities of Sony Xperia devices:

  1. GFXBench – Measures graphics rendering performance, assessing various heavy-duty graphic tasks.
  2. 3DMark – A popular benchmarking tool that evaluates the capabilities of mobile GPUs, focusing on gaming performance.
  3. GameBench – Provides insights into real-time performance metrics during gameplay, including frame rates and responsiveness.

Sony Xperia models, equipped with advanced GPUs like the Adreno series, deliver impressive graphical performance. As a result, users can expect smooth gameplay, stunning visuals, and efficient multi-tasking while using demanding applications or engaging in graphics-intensive entertainment.

Comparison of Sony Xperia Performance to Competitors

When comparing Sony Xperia performance benchmarks to its competitors, it is evident that the brand has established itself within a competitive landscape. Rivals such as Samsung’s Galaxy series and Apple’s iPhone line often lead in raw performance metrics, mainly due to their cutting-edge processors.

Xperia devices, powered by Qualcomm’s latest Snapdragon chipsets, hold their own in multi-core scores but can lag slightly behind flagship models from Apple, which benefit from optimized software and hardware integration. Notably, the latest Xperia models excel in GPU performance, particularly in graphics-intensive applications, competing closely with established leaders.

For users focused on everyday tasks and multitasking capabilities, Sony Xperia demonstrates a balanced approach with commendable performance. However, its performance in high-end gaming may not always match that of competitors, like the ROG Phone series, designed explicitly for gaming proficiency.

Ultimately, while Sony Xperia performance benchmarks demonstrate significant capabilities, they may not consistently outperform competitors across all categories, suggesting a niche positioning within the broader smartphone market.
